Never Drop

AI-Powered Business Card Scanning

Never Drop utilizes cutting-edge AI-powered Optical Character Recognition (OCR) technology to scan any business card in seconds. This feature instantly extracts critical details, including the contact's name, company, title, phone number, and email, removing the need for tedious manual entry.

Context Enrichment

Gone are the days of generic email addresses. This feature allows users to enrich captured leads by automatically finding verified work emails based on the contact's name and company. This ensures that you never have to guess or waste time searching for accurate contact information.

Personalized AI Drafts

Never Drop's standout feature is its ability to generate personalized follow-up emails based on your conversation context and voice notes. This means you can review and send a tailored email in under two minutes, ensuring that your follow-up feels personal and relevant, not just another generic template.

Team Collaboration and Organization

Designed for fast-paced environments, Never Drop allows teams to organize scans by event and reassign leads among team members. The dashboard provides a comprehensive view of team activity, ensuring everyone stays aligned and no lead falls through the cracks.

Random Daily Urls

Human-Curated Discovery

Every single link is hand-picked by Steven Irby, a software engineer who has been building on the web since the 1990s. This process is explicitly "No AI. No BS." It relies on a human eye for quality, quirkiness, and soul—things algorithms consistently miss. You're getting a recommendation from someone who has watched corners of the web appear and disappear, ensuring each URL has a genuine point of interest.

The format is ruthlessly simple: one URL, Monday through Friday, with minimal framing. This intentional constraint forces quality over quantity and respects your intelligence. Steven might add a brief note for context, but the conclusions are yours to draw. It’s a refreshing departure from over-explained listicles and hot takes, turning each email into a starting point for your own exploration.

Archive and Random Explorer

Beyond the daily email, the Random Daily Urls website hosts a full archive of every link ever sent. This is paired with a "Random" button, allowing you to dive into the back catalog for instant, serendipitous discovery. It transforms the newsletter from a fleeting email into a permanent, explorable repository of the web's oddities and wonders.

Focus on the "Web's Soul"

The curation deliberately avoids mainstream, SEO-driven content. Instead, it focuses on personal websites, digital art projects, forgotten experiments, and things people made simply because they felt like it. This mission is a direct counter to the flattened, platform-dominated modern web, actively seeking out links that have personality and heart.

About Random Daily Urls

Random Daily Urls is a defiantly simple, human-curated newsletter that serves as a daily antidote to the algorithmically-saturated internet. Every weekday, you receive exactly one email containing a single, interesting website link. This isn't about life hacks, productivity tips, or the latest viral news. It's a deliberate excavation of the web's weird, wonderful, and often forgotten corners, personally unearthed by software engineer and longtime internet builder, Steven Irby. The core value proposition is pure, unadulterated discovery. Steven acts as your personal internet archaeologist, digging up personal sites, digital experiments, and obscure gems buried under layers of SEO and platform monotony. He presents them with minimal commentary, allowing you to explore, be surprised, and form your own conclusions. It’s for anyone who misses the soulful, personal feel of the early web, who craves serendipity over optimization, and who believes the most interesting ideas aren't on the first page of Google. This isn't a tool for your workflow; it's a daily dose of digital curiosity and proof that the web is still alive.

Random Daily Urls FAQ

How much does Random Daily Urls cost?

It is completely free. There is no paid tier, subscription fee, or premium version. The newsletter is a passion project by Steven Irby, offered as a free daily service to anyone who wants to rediscover the interesting corners of the web.

What kind of websites do you feature?

The focus is on the weird, wonderful, and personal. You can expect to find personal blogs and sites, digital art and experiments, interactive web projects, obscure tools made for fun, historical web artifacts, and occasionally a mainstream site viewed through a unique lens. The common thread is that they are interesting, human-made, and often buried by modern search.

Can I submit a website for consideration?

Yes. The website features a "SUBMIT" link, allowing anyone to suggest a URL they believe fits the newsletter's ethos. This helps Steven discover gems he might have missed and fosters a community of fellow internet archaeologists.
